Foot treatment
  • Dry, cracked feet? Rub some coconut oil and go
    over the flaky areas with a pumice stone. For an
    intense treatment, slather on the oil, put an old
    pair of socks and leave overnight.

Hand cream
  • In a double boiler, melt together 10
    tablespoons coconut oil, 3 tablespoons cold
    pressed sweet almond oil and 4 tablespoons
    grated beeswax. Remove pot from the burner and
    stir in 5 drops of lemon essential oil. After
    cooling, massage it into your hands to hydrate
    and banish dark spots. I put some into an empty
    lip balm or mini-mints tin and pop it into the
    purse for easy access.
